Claude Code v2.1.229

Rate-limit checkpoint can pre-queue "continue"

Not switched on
Useful3 Signal3
Rate Limits

Hitting a rate-limit checkpoint can prefill "continue" for you, cancelled if you upgrade instead.

Auto-queued 'continue' at a rate-limit checkpoint is wired with telemetry but nothing in the build turns it on.

What

The prompt can prefill and queue the word "continue" when you hit a rate-limit checkpoint, and cancels that prefill if you take the upgrade offer instead. The cancellation is reported to telemetry as tengu_rl_checkpoint_auto_continue_cancelled_by_upsell. Nothing in the build source turns this on, so whether it runs is decided elsewhere.
